Output 2388ffe72ade99795b03ecbed9ed839fb340bfcc919ff0367b99049788d18dec:0

value
1085885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59e15a71e6c6e86e163b45e19536cf54c91bc766 OP_EQUALVERIFY OP_CHECKSIG
address
19CF6ttrngGFaqtFL5331aJQWjrcSyLV25
transaction
2388ffe72ade99795b03ecbed9ed839fb340bfcc919ff0367b99049788d18dec
spent
true